Select which Packet Processor firmware image (includes Application,
FPGA, and FFPGA) is loaded upon bootup:
0 – Latest: Boot the newer firmware image based upon date.
1 – Image1: Boot the firmware image loaded into the first slot in
permanent storage.
2 – Image2: Boot the firmware image loaded into the second slot in
Select which Packet Processor or Base Modem firmware image
(includes Application, FPGA, and FFPGA) is overwritten in the Firmware
Update FTP process:
0 – Oldest: Updates the older firmware image based upon date.
1 – Image1: Updates the firmware image loaded into the first slot in
permanent storage.
2 – Image2: Updates the firmware image loaded into the second slot
Select which Base Modem firmware image is loaded upon bootup. The
possible options are:
0 – Latest: Boot the newer firmware package based upon date.
1- Image1: Boot the firmware image loaded into the first slot in
permanent storage.
2 – Image2: Boot the firmware image loaded into the second slot in
Codecast Multicast Address
Set the Multicast address used by VLOAD to upgrade the modem
firmware and param file via streaming Multicast. Must match the
address specified in VLOAD.
Select the PARAM file that is loaded on bootup:
1 – Last saved Parameter file
2 -Factory – uses the internal, hard-coded factory default parameters.
